The Night Terrors ‘Nasty’ EP out now – free download

Nothing in this world is for free i’ve been told so many times throughout my life, so what’s the catch with The Night Terrors ‘Nasty’ 4 track EP?!?! There doesn’t appear to be one, it’s a free download so we’re just going to have to deal with it and stop looking over our shoulders.

The ‘Nasty’ EP is chillingly stunning. Haunting lyrical tones combine with a rhythm that draws you into the dark mysterious world that The Night Terrors frequent in, if this is what a dark alley sounds like on a misty night then i’m all for a bit of a fright.

All four songs are brilliant put together, ‘Video Nasty’ is looking like my favourite, it’s a hair stander on the back of your neck job, full of rhythmic pace setting the tone for what’s to come. Things slow down with ‘Purgatory Soul’ and ‘Stone’ where you get to learn a bit more what the bands sound is all about. The Ep is wrapped up with ‘Fear The Worst’ and i’m left disappointed it’s all over. The Night Terrors are a very capable band indeed so hopefully an album won’t be too long a wait.
